Harnessing Bandwidth Potential: Dense Wavelength Division Multiplexing Across Asia
Data demand across Asia is surging at an unprecedented rate. To meet this insatiable appetite for connectivity, telecom providers are increasingly turning to sophisticated technologies like Dense Wavelength Division Multiplexing (DWDM). This methodology allows multiple wavelengths to be transmitted simultaneously over a single fiber optic cable, dramatically increasing bandwidth capacity.
DWDM's ability to optimally utilize existing infrastructure makes it an ideal solution for densely populated areas like Asia, where laying new cables can be costly and time-consuming. Furthermore, DWDM offers enhanced signal quality and reduced latency, creating the way for seamless video conferencing experiences.
As Asian nations continue their digital transformation, DWDM is poised to play a crucial role in connecting people, businesses, and governments. Its widespread deployment will undoubtedly fuel economic growth and innovation across the region.
DWDM Solutions for Enterprise Growth in APAC
The Asia-Pacific (APAC) region is experiencing substantial growth, with enterprises continuously seeking ways to enhance their network capabilities. Dense Wavelength Division Multiplexing (DWDM) technologies are playing a crucial role in enabling this expansion by providing high-capacity data transmission over existing fiber infrastructure. DWDM's ability to concurrently carry multiple wavelengths of light allows for significant bandwidth increases, enabling the demands of high-bandwidth applications such as cloud computing, video conferencing, and synchronous data transfer.
- Enterprises in APAC are increasingly adopting DWDM to improve their network performance and reduce operational costs.
- Significant benefits of implementing DWDM include increased bandwidth capacity, reduced latency, improved signal quality, and adaptability to meet future growth demands.
- Additionally, DWDM technologies are integrated with existing fiber infrastructure, minimizing disruption during deployment.
As the demand for bandwidth continues to escalate in the APAC region, DWDM solutions will remain a critical component of enterprise network infrastructure.
